wwltvsports Malcolm Jenkins missed his third straight practice and HC Sean Payton labeled him as day-to-day.
wwltvsports Usual suspects sat out/ were limited Sunday: Z. Keasey, R. Meachem, D. Henderson, C. Ingram, G. Sharpe, D. Sharper
wwltvsports Several players said today's heat/humidity was the worst they've seen yet. Expect it to get worse than this
wwltvsports J. Stinchcomb said he's progressing well with his sports hernia. Coaching staff is letting him do what he thinks he can do w/out re-injuring
